The Corona Ultra RS Charged Aerosol Detector (CAD) is a cutting-edge detector designed to enhance the capabilities of ultra-high-performance liquid chromatography (UHPLC). Utilizing charged aerosol detection technology, the detector offers unparalleled sensitivity and reliability across a diverse range of applications, making it a favored choice for pharmaceutical companies, food and beverage testing, specialty chemicals, and biofuels analysis.

The Corona Ultra RS provides a consistent response that is largely independent of the chemical structure of analytes. This feature allows for the detection and relative quantification of non-volatile and semi-volatile compounds without the need for analyte-specific standards. With a dynamic range spanning over four orders of magnitude, the detector is highly effective for both trace analysis and routine quality control. Additionally, its compatibility with the most advanced UHPLC systems, such as the UltiMate® 3000 RSLC system, ensures versatility and ease of integration into any laboratory environment.

Technical Specifications

  • Mobile Phase Flow Rate: 0.2–2.0 mL/min
  • Compatible Materials: Stainless steel (316 and Nitronic® 60), Valcon H, Valcon E, PEEK™, Teflon®
  • Dynamic Range: Full-scale output from 1 pA to 500 pA (in 1-2-5 sequence)
  • Noise Levels: <750 fA peak-to-peak (using 20% methanol/80% water)
  • Signal Output: 0–1 V DC, with a resolution of 0.12 µV at full scale
  • Data Output Frequency: Maximum of 200 Hz
  • Temperature Control:
    • Nebulizer temperature range: 5–35°C (factory-set at 25°C)
    • Temperature stability: < ±0.5°C
  • Integrated Features:
    • 6-port, 2-position switching valve
    • Adjustable flow splitter with ratios of 1:1 to 20:1
    • Flow diversion system for waste bottle overfill prevention
  • Power Requirements: 100/240 VAC, 50/60 Hz, 100 VA
  • Gas Requirements: High-purity gas (air or nitrogen), free from hydrocarbons, particulates, and water vapor
    • Input Pressure: 60 psig (4.14 bar)
    • Operating Pressure: 35 psig (2.41 bar)
  • Physical Dimensions: 22.9 cm × 44.5 cm × 55.9 cm (Height × Width × Depth)
  • Weight: 12.3 kg (27 lbs)
  • Certifications:
    • USA: UL 61010A-1
    • Canada: CSA Standard C22.2 No. 1010.1-92
    • EU: EN 61326:1997 + A1:1998, EN 61010-1 (2001-02)
    • FCC: Part 15 Subpart B Class A

Key Features and Benefits

  • Consistent Response: Independent of the chemical structure of analytes, ideal for quantifying unknown compounds.
  • Wide Dynamic Range: Spanning over four orders of magnitude for effective trace and bulk analyses.
  • Ease of Use: Simple integration with UHPLC systems and minimal optimization required.
  • Enhanced Detection: Capable of detecting non-chromophoric and low-volatility compounds beyond the capabilities of UV and mass spectrometry.
